Disproportionality and Disaster: Hurricane Katrina and the Mississippi River-Gulf Outlet
Although many observers have interpreted Hurricane Katrina's damage to New Orleans as a case of nature striking humans, we draw on the sociological concept of the growth machine to show that much of the damage resulted instead from what humans had done to nature-in the name but not the reality of "economic development."
